Seen a few things on Grealish, some reports that we have offered to pay half his wages (£150K a week / £7.8m) for the year and City want the full amount.
I have seen before where players wanted moves they temporarily took reductions in their wage to make the move happen, Lingard when he went from Man utd to West Ham, and Danny Drinkwater when he went to Burnley on loan from Chelsea. But I know thats quite rare and normally when the player is very keen on the move.
I remember when we signed James, there was a suggestion that we paid £12m to get him out of his Real Madrid contract and Madrid essentially just gave that money to James and then he signed a new contract with us. I could see something like that happening, Like we pay £20m for Grealish, City give him that money and terminate his contract and he signs a new contract with us, on reduced wages, but with £20m in the bank.
